Soft-deleted rows in the orders table at Tillhaven Commerce are still appearing in the nightly revenue rollup. The deleted_at filter is applied in the API layer but not in the rollup's raw SQL, so cancelled orders inflate totals. For the new contractor: the rollup lives in the Ledgerloom repo under batch jobs. Please add the filter, backfill the last 30 days, and verify against the finance snapshot. The affected pipeline run is identified by the token below.

build token for kagaf-hahof: htk14_9d3d4d26d7d8de

Managers' Wiki — Legacy Pricing Update (Restricted)

Heads up: legacy customers on old Brindlemark plans are getting a price bump next quarter. Expect some grumbling — talking points are on the Retention page. Don't promise exemptions; escalate hardship cases to your regional director. Timing ties into a bigger move, noted confidentially just below.

board note of bawep-tajef: Queniusek Systems plans to raise the Quenvan list price by 53.1 percent in March. The pricing group signed off on a budget of $176.4 million for Project Drueth. The renewal with Casionix Partners closes at $142.5 million a year, 8.3 percent below the last contract. Project Fraax slips by six weeks because of the tooling delay.

This PR adds token-bucket rate limiting to the Gatekeep gateway for all internal service routes. If you're new to the team: limits apply per caller identity, not per route, and rejected requests return a retry hint header. Defaults were chosen from last quarter's traffic on the Brindlewood cluster. The constants below control bucket size and refill behavior.

tuning constants:
RATE_LIMITS = {
    "wenwyn": 1,
    "zorix": 10,
    "oliix": 2,
    "holael": 10,
}

Ticket: Signature verification failed on SlotWeaver 4.2.1 release

During the staged rollout of SlotWeaver, our school timetable solver, the artifact verifier rejected the build with a digest mismatch. I rebuilt from a clean tag and confirmed the checksum is correct, so the failure points to a stale verification key on the release host. Please re-register the current signing key on the distribution box. For reference, the correct key is as follows.

signing key of bagap-yawep = bky13_TbfT6ZMUoGJo2